Maharashtra is one of the most industrialized states in India, with a diverse range of industries. The state is
home to many MSMEs, including manufacturing, services, and agriculture-based industries. Maharashtra
being a leading industrial state has incorporated the policy interventions like Make in India and Make in
Maharashtra, giving the much-required impetus to its vast Micro, Small and Medium Enterprises (MSME). The
state contributes around 13% of the total MSME output in India.
Maharashtra economy is mainly driven by manufacturing, finance, international trade, mass media,
technology, petroleum, fashion, apparel, gems, and jewellery, IT & ITeS and tourism. With count more than
47 lakhs of MSME, Maharashtra contributes 8 percent share in the country, 27 percent of exports, it is one of
the most appealing investment sites in the country and it reflects highest UDYAM registration of MSME in the
country.
Maharashtra is India's third-largest state, accounting for almost 9.4% of the country's total land area, With
three international airports, about 3,03,000 kilometres of road and 6,165 kilometres of rail system. The state
has a 720km coastline and 55 ports that support around 22% of India's total freight transportation.
The Ministry of Micro, Small and Medium Enterprises (MSMEs) implements various schemes to increase
employment opportunities of MSME sector in the country. These includes Prime Minister Employment
Generation Programme (PMEGP), Pradhan Mantri MUDRA Yojana (PMMY), Emergency Credit Line Guarantee
Scheme (ECLGS) , Special Credit Linked Capital Subsidy Scheme (SCLCSS) ,Micro and Small Enterprises-
Cluster Development Programme (MSE-CDP), Scheme of Fund for Regeneration of Traditional Industries
(SFURTI), Credit Guarantee Fund Trust for Micro and Small Enterprises (CGTMSE) and A Scheme for
Promoting Innovation, Rural Industry & Entrepreneurship (ASPIRE).
Adding this, the government of Maharashtra has also undertaken schemes like Chief Minister Employment
Generation Programme (CMEGP), Zero Defect Zero Effect (ZED scheme), initiate Maharashtra Industry, Trade
& Investment Facilitation Cell (MAITRI) promotes cluster promotion, facilitate public funding for the MSME's.
